MARIANAS High School graduate Anthony Jacob “Jakey” Camacho Deleon Guerrero has been named to the University of Hawaii Mānoa’s Dean’s List for the fall semester of 2023.

Full-time undergraduate students are awarded the Dean’s List distinction when they earn a semester grade point average of 3.5 or higher. 

A seasoned CNMI national swimmer, Deleon Guerrero is pursuing a degree in civil engineering. He is the son of Special Assistant for Public Transportation Alfreda Camacho Maratita.

As a senior high school student, Deleon Guerrero completed the Youth Leadership Academy of the Asian Pacific American Institute for Congressional Studies in Washington, D.C. in October 2022. He was the only student who represented the Pacific Island territories in the weeklong program, which included a tour in and around the nation’s capital.

The University of Hawaiʻi at Mānoa is the largest and oldest of the 10 University of Hawaii campuses. Mānoa offers hundreds of undergraduate, graduate, and professional degrees; a strong, vital research program; and nationally ranked NCAA Division I athletics.
